So here is the current situation i am currently working on, we have 2
locations with various types of servers on both and we would like to use WAN
Proxy as a WAN Optimization software to reduce the amount of data flowing
between the 2 locations to save costs and here comes the questions:

   1. How should  the network be setup now ? should i install the 2 servers
   with wan proxy with 2 interfaces on each server, one facing the local
   network on the location and one facing the public network (Internet), where
   those WAN Proxy servers will be the gateway to both of the networks ? and if
   so, then which one should be the WAN Proxy server and which should be the
   client ?
   2. If the above infrastructure is correct then what template should i
   follow to send all the traffic between the 2 locations, something like this
   one<http://lists.wanproxy.org/pipermail/wanproxy-wanproxy.org/2009-June/000009.html>,
   or the "Proxying over a WAN using SOCKS".<http://wanproxy.org/examples.shtml>
